| cd01833 | XynB_like | 4.37e-38 | 504 | 707 | 1 | 157 | SGNH_hydrolase subfamily, similar to Ruminococcus flavefaciens XynB. Most likely a secreted hydrolase with xylanase activity. SGNH hydrolases are a diverse family of lipases and esterases. The tertiary fold of the enzyme is substantially different from that of the alpha/beta hydrolase family and unique among all known hydrolases; its active site closely resembles the Ser-His-Asp(Glu) triad found in other serine hydrolases. |
| cd00229 | SGNH_hydrolase | 5.13e-15 | 509 | 704 | 4 | 185 | SGNH_hydrolase, or GDSL_hydrolase, is a diverse family of lipases and esterases. The tertiary fold of the enzyme is substantially different from that of the alpha/beta hydrolase family and unique among all known hydrolases; its active site closely resembles the typical Ser-His-Asp(Glu) triad from other serine hydrolases, but may lack the carboxlic acid. |
